Explanation of different skin types: oily, dry, combination, and sensitive. Importance of identifying skin type for tailored care.Skin types vary among men, and knowing yours is key to good care. There are four main types:
- Oily: Shiny and can have large pores.
- Dry: Rough, flaky, and may feel tight.
- Combination: Oily in some areas and dry in others.
- Sensitive: Easily irritated and prone to redness.
Identifying your skin type helps you choose the right products. This way, you can give your skin what it needs. Tailored care leads to better results and a fresh look!

Step 2: Exfoliation
Explanation of the exfoliation process and its significance in skin care. Recommended exfoliation frequency and types of exfoliators for men.Exfoliation is like giving your skin a fresh start. This process removes dead skin cells, making way for new ones. It’s important because it helps prevent clogged pores and keeps your skin smooth. For most guys, exfoliating 1 to 3 times a week works best. There are two main types of exfoliators: physical and chemical. Physical exfoliators scrub away the dead skin, while chemical ones break it down. Let’s look at a quick comparison!
| Type | Description | Example |
|---|---|---|
| Physical | Scrubs with tiny beads or grains. | Facial scrubs |
| Chemical | Products with acids that dissolve dead skin. | Alpha Hydroxy Acid (AHA) |
So, pick the one that suits your skin. Remember, a little exfoliation goes a long way. And no, you shouldn’t be scrubbing so hard that your skin feels like sandpaper!

Step 4: Sun Protection
Risks associated with UV exposure for men’s skin. Recommendations for effective sunscreen options.Sun exposure can harm men’s skin. UV rays can cause sunburn, dark spots, and early aging. Over time, this damage may lead to skin cancer. It’s important to protect your skin from these risks.
Choosing the right sunscreen matters. Look for these types:
- Broad-spectrum sunscreen: Protects against UVA and UVB rays.
- SPF 30 or higher: Blocks 97% of UVB rays.
- Water-resistant: Keeps working longer during sweat or water activities.
Apply sunscreen every two hours for best results, especially when outside. Don’t skip this step in your routine!

Addressing Specific Skin Concerns
Solutions for common issues: acne, razor burn, and aging. Recommended products and treatments for targeted concerns.Skin problems are common for many men. Three big issues are acne, razor burn, and aging. Luckily, there are simple solutions. For acne, use a gentle cleanser with salicylic acid. To soothe razor burn, apply an alcohol-free aftershave. For aging, look for creams with Vitamin C and retinol.
- **Acne:** Salicylic acid cleansers
- **Razor Burn:** Alcohol-free aftershave
- **Aging:** Creams with Vitamin C and retinol
With these products, you can keep your skin healthy and fresh!

How can I avoid razor burn?
To prevent razor burn, **shave using a sharp razor** and **apply a soothing aftershave**. This keeps the skin calm.
Razor Burn Tips:
- Use warm water before shaving.
- Shave with the hair’s direction.
- Moisturize afterward.

How Can Men Identify Their Skin Type (Oily, Dry, Combination, Or Sensitive) To Select The Right Products For Customized Care?To find out your skin type, look at your face after washing it. If your skin feels tight and flaky, you have dry skin. If it shines and looks oily, you have oily skin. If your cheeks are dry but your forehead is oily, you have combination skin. If your skin itches or gets red easily, you might have sensitive skin. Knowing your skin type helps you pick the right products for care!
What Ingredients Should Men Look For In Skincare Products To Address Specific Concerns Such As Acne, Aging, Or Dryness?If you have acne, look for products with salicylic acid. This helps to clean your skin and clear bumps. For aging skin, use creams with hyaluronic acid. This ingredient keeps your skin plump and fresh. If your skin feels dry, find moisturizers with glycerin. This ingredient helps trap water in your skin.
